The picture looks very good after working on the gray scale. I want to max the raster usage for output. When I set it up, the image was just inside the tube face and I had banding on the left side. Looking at the tube, I could see black masking being drawn on the tube face. Very faint, but noticeable. Once I shrank that inside the tube, the banding disappeared. I want to look into making sure I use all the tube face for light output. Just not sure why there was banding. The convergence grid was centered on the install. Anyhow, I will continue on with the project.
Will have someone come out and calibrate it properly once its dialed in. I'd like to move the PJ forward if possible after working on raster usage.

Had some time to mount the Red Quail lens and compare some test material. The first thing that stood out to me was that the image size of the Quail lens is the same as the HD144. I did not move the projector forward or back, just mechanical focus and electrical focus. Did a comparison of the star chart with both lenses, Red tube on, and could not see any appreciable increase of resolution. I wanted to, but I will not convince myself it's better. The quail lens focuses well in the corners. The mechanical focus has to be touched up on the other colors, but for this quick test Red was my main concern. It was hard to get a good picture of the red starburst. All pictures are from the Quail lens.

Forget that starburst pattern, it has no usable feature for fixed pixel raster displays other than generating moire pattern. Instead use proper 1:1, 2:2, 3:3 test pattern, or full screen small text for readability. In the other thread I also wrote down how can you evaluate the optical quality of the lens, that also worth a try.
